Plot Summary
Christianshavn 1894 - Headstrong Juliane fights alongside her husband Otto for love and family in strike-ridden Christianshavn. The couple has been married for five years and has two children together. Trade union politics are taking up more and more of Otto's life, and Juliane cannot even get him to tone it down at family gatherings, so Juliane has her hands full keeping track of the home and the children. The family argues about big and small things, from the sisters' disagreement about women's liberation to Otto's political involvement.
